THE PROBLEM

The paperwork tax on care

Clinical staff are buried in documentation and administration — letters, coding, rotas, ordering — work that is essential but rarely the work they trained for. It is a tax paid in time, attention and, ultimately, burnout.

Most of it is repetitive, structured and well-suited to automation. The barrier has never been whether it could be done, but whether it could be done safely, accurately, and inside the systems people already use.

INTEGRATION

Alongside the systems you already run

Operational AI earns its place by fitting in, not by demanding a migration. We integrate with the clinical systems already in use — SystmOne, EMIS, ePMA and the rest — and sit alongside them rather than replacing them.

That means no rip-and-replace, no parallel record to maintain, and a deployment path that respects how a service actually runs day to day.
